Part Overview

The 1N828 from Microchip Technology is a Zener diode rated for 6.2 V nominal Zener voltage, 500 mW maximum power dissipation, and ±5% tolerance, supplied in a DO-35 axial through-hole package. It features a maximum impedance (Zzt) of 15 Ohms and operates within a temperature range of -55°C to 175°C. The device is RoHS non-compliant, has unlimited moisture sensitivity level, and is currently active in production.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itute and equivalent parts for the 1N828 are determined based on strict adherence to shared electrical and mechanical parameters, specifically: Zener voltage (6.2 V nominal), tolerance (±5%), maximum power dissipation (≥400 mW), maximum impedance (≤15 Ohms), reverse leakage current, operating temperature range, mounting type, and package compatibility (DO-35, Axial). Substitute parts provided are only those matching these criteria as specified in the input.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

Selection among these substitute Zener diodes should consider product status (active), compliance with RoHS and environmental requirements, and any specified qualification standards (such as military qualification for JANTX1N827-1). Where environmental compliance is mandatory, choose parts with ROHS3 status. For military or high-reliability applications, select devices with explicit qualification such as MIL-PRF-19500/159. Ensure that the part status is active for continuity of supply.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1. What parameters are required for Zener diode substitution in the 1N828 category?
A1. Substitution is based strictly on the following parameters: Zener voltage (6.2 V nom.), tolerance (±5%), maximum power (≥400 mW), impedance (≤15 Ohms), reverse leakage at specified voltage, operating temperature range, mounting type, and package (DO-35 axial).

Q2. Are all substitute parts compatible with the original 1N828 PCB footprint and mounting?
A2. All listed substitutes use the DO-204AH, DO-35, Axial package with through-hole mounting, ensuring mechanical compatibility with the 1N828.

Q3. Are there differences in environmental or compliance characteristics among substitutes?
A3. Some parts, such as 1N821A, are ROHS3 compliant, while others such as 1N828, 1N821-1, 1N829, and JANTX1N827-1 are RoHS non-compliant.

Q4. Which substitute has military or high-reliability qualification?
A4. JANTX1N827-1 includes military-grade qualification to MIL-PRF-19500/159.

Q5. What are key considerations when selecting between substitutes?
A5. Consider matching Zener voltage, tolerance, power, impedance, reverse leakage, and any necessary compliance or qualification requirements.

Q6. Are the electrical parameters, such as impedance and leakage current, consistent across all listed substitutes?
A6. All listed equivalents match the 1N828 impedance (15 Ohms max) except 1N5234BTR, which has 7 Ohms. Leakage current and operating temperature ranges vary as specified in the comparison table.

Q7. Can the 1N821A be used interchangeably with the 1N828?
A7. 1N821A matches voltage, tolerance, impedance, and package but has a lower maximum power rating (400 mW) and ROHS3 compliance. Refer to the comparison table for parameter alignment.
